摘要
In order to enable Ultra-Wideband (UWB) spectral mask compatibility and provide simple hardware implementation, novel pulse shaping methods based on orthonormal Hermite functions are proposed to enable the pulses to fulfill given spectral mask. Simulation results show that the proposed method can be used to obtain pulses that fulfill the FCC spectral mask, optimize transmission power spectrum, and realize simple hardware implementation as well.
